The Senior Project Manager for the Fleet and Facilities department will take charge of streamlining project execution to deliver new construction, renovations and capital improvements for critical County facilities. Spearheading complex projects from initial concept through final construction while mentoring and empowering Project Managers to elevate team performance. You will be integrating eco-friendly practices and County best practices into every project phase minimizing environmental impact and optimizing cost effectiveness. You will be fostering a culture of clear collaborative communication across all stakeholders keeping everyone informed and engaged. Pursuing Adams County vision to be the most inclusive and innovative county in America.* Develops conceptual plans and budgets for facilities projects.* Develops planning documents for initiation of projects.* Coordinates with elected offices and departments to facilitate facility planning, project budgeting, and scheduling.* Develops and maintains facility project budgets.* Coordinates all parties involved in the planning, design, and construction process.* Prepares requests for proposal bids and participates in all necessary meetings to facilitate selecting contractors and services.* Coordinates with evaluation committees to develop recommendations for selection of professional services, construction services, and contractors.* Conducts pre-construction meetings, reviews all bids, and recommends award of contract.* Prepares presentation materials for public hearings, study sessions, and reporting to multiple County departments and leadership.* Monitors and support PM staff in monitoring construction contracts, execution, and distribution.* Reviews contract plans and specifications for compliance with appropriate building codes and project requirements.* Provide support to PD & C Manager in monitoring and reporting on all phases of planning and construction.* Prepares contract change orders and monitors their execution.* Receives pay requests from professional consultants and contractors and approves for payment.* Monitors and facilitates resolution of construction contract disputes and claims.* Monitors construction contract close-out and maintains documentation files.* Assists in development of new standards of practice for project management activities. .* Coordinates and supports the Facilities Maintenance and Operations functions with collaboration, assistance, leadership, and technical expertise as required.* Coordinates with elected offices and departments on Sustainability practices, opportunities, and implementation. Initiatives may be based on energy consumption, sustainability, or similarly focused programs that extend beyond Facilities to county wide programs.* Collaborates with and sets a positive example in developing and maintaining a sustainable culture within the county.* Performs other related duties and responsibilities as required* May exercise direct supervision over PDC Project Manager staff and day to day direction of work.* Knowledge of facilities planning and construction management processes and procedures.* Knowledge of estimating, budgeting, and scheduling practices.* Knowledge of status of costs of new construction, escalation factors, and market trends.* Knowledge of building codes and standards of practice.* Knowledge of laws governing construction contracts and contracting.* Knowledge of construction materials and methods.* Demonstrate practical understanding of integrated facility design and construction (including facility programming), building types/uses, and common construction practices,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), building codes and regulatory compliance.* Demonstrate understanding and application of sustainable, energy efficient, or other environmentally sensitive practices. Focus will not only be on facilities, but also include county wide functions and best practices.* Highly experienced in developing Request for Proposals (RFP) and Bids for design/consulting services, competitive bid documents for facility projects and furniture, fixtures, and equipment assessment and procurement.* Highly skilled at defining/assessing project work scope; facility programming and space planning; broad and practical understanding of construction means/methods to ensure that projects achieve their goals and objectives in a timely and cost-effective manner.* Must have the ability strategically plan facility needs, see the 'big picture', and anticipate future space demands* Must have excellent communication and presentation skills, working and communicating with all organizational levels and project stakeholders.*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Office applications, AutoCAD (or equal), and other software (i.e., Adobe Acrobat Std/Pro, Construction Estimating programs)* Ability to prepare reports and documents that integrate text, graphics, and quantitative information.* Highly skilled in technology to effectively manage workflow, using smart phone/tablet, applications, traditional laptop/desktop applications, digital photography, etc.* Highly skilled in reading and interpreting plans and specifications* Demonstrate advance understanding of monitoring construction progress.* Ability to communicate clearly and concisely, both orally and in writing.* Ability to establish, maintain, and foster positive and harmonious working relationships with those contacted in the course of worEducation* Bachelor's Degree in Architecture, Engineering, and Construction management or, any equivalent combination of experience and/or education from which comparable knowledge, skills and abilities have been achieved.Experience* Minimum five (5) years of established experience in project management as an owner's project representative, on a wide range and number of small to moderate commercial facility projects and building types, managing design and specialty consultants, general contractors and sub-contractors, furniture, fixtures, and equipment vendors.* At least two (2) years of mentoring and/or leading a team of Project Managers.* Experience with sustainability and energy management initiatives, LEAN practices, or similar efficiency focused programs is a plus.License and/or certification* Possession of a valid CO Driver's License with no restrictions or ability to obtain within 30 days of hire.* Certification in Project Management, Energy Management, or similar sustainability focused experience is a plus.Background Check* Must pass a criminal background check to include a Motor Vehicle check.#J-18808-Ljbffr
